Three Key Points of CNC Machining Speed Control
CNC precision processing plant is developing towards high speed and high efficiency. This includes speed control of NC machining. In order to make full use of the effective working stroke, it is necessary to accelerate the moving parts to the high speed stroke in a short time, and stop in the high speed stroke. This is why it is necessary to control the speed of CNC machining.
1. Flexible acceleration and deceleration control
In CNC machining in Shenzhen, the specific automatic speed regulation function is generally directly realized by the system program. In this way, it is necessary to change the acceleration and deceleration characteristics of the system or modify the NC program through addition and subtraction control, so ordinary users cannot make the NC machine tool have the best acceleration and deceleration performance according to their own needs. Desire. Therefore, the flexible acceleration and deceleration control method proposed by us adopts the database principle, divides the acceleration and deceleration control into two parts: acceleration and deceleration description and implementation, and separates the acceleration and deceleration description from the system program. In the NC system software, a general control channel independent of the acceleration and deceleration database content is designed to independently complete the acceleration and deceleration calculation and trajectory control.
2. Flexible automatic acceleration control
Set the acceleration curve, analytical curve and non analytical curve, and store them in the acceleration and deceleration curve library as templates in the form of digital tables.
3. Flexible automatic deceleration control
The acceleration control is also stored in the acceleration and deceleration curve library in the form of a digital table as a template. Reasonable automatic acceleration and deceleration control is an important link to ensure the dynamic performance of CNC machine tools. The automatic acceleration and deceleration control based on fixed curve in the traditional Dongguan CNC precision processing plant lacks flexibility. The acceleration and deceleration process is difficult to ensure the coordination with the machine tool performance, and it is difficult to optimize the dynamic characteristics of the machine tool movement.
